Sea mines and Fire Bombs has core features and require implement first, has "outside" of the actual F/A-18C modules but affect to all incendiary bombs on simulator, and Sea Mines require implemente some technologies first to working sea environment into DCS World (ex Underwater explosiones, ships damage models, magnetic / acoustic / influence fuzes, a sonnar engine, flodding, etc).
